Datemid 20th-late 20th century
MediumMachine-stitched paper
DimensionsPrimary Dimensions (width x depth): 5 3/4 x 12 1/4in. (14.6 x 31.1cm)
ClassificationsCostume
Credit LineGift of Mrs. Richard Koopman
Object number1995.30.54a,b
DescriptionCrinkled-texture brown paper slippers: the paddle-shaped bottom piece and half-oval top piece are serged together around the outside edge with white thread.
